Thực hành Hệ điều hành - Bài thực hành số 7: Cài đặt HDH Linux + Boot Loader

Linux không đòi hỏi cấu hình mạnh, tuy nhiên phần cứng có cấu hình thấp quá thì không chạy được
X Window (hệ thống giao diện đồ hoạ trên Linux). Cấu hình tối thiểu đối với phiên bản FedoraCore
8:
- Bộ vi xử lý: tối thiểu Pentium 200 MHz cho TextMode, Pentium 400 MHz cho Graphic
Mode
- RAM: 128MB trở lên cho TextMode, 192MB cho Graphic Mode.
- Đĩa cứng HDD: dung lượng còn tuỳ thuộc vào các loại cài đặt:
o Server: khoảng 2 GB
o Personal Desktop: khoản 3GB
o Workstation: khoản 3.5GB
o Custom installation: 1.8G - 10 GB 
pdf 12 trang xuanthi 30/12/2022 2040
Bạn đang xem tài liệu "Thực hành Hệ điều hành - Bài thực hành số 7: Cài đặt HDH Linux + Boot Loader", để tải tài liệu gốc về máy hãy click vào nút Download ở trên.

File đính kèm:

  • pdfthuc_hanh_he_dieu_hanh_bai_thuc_hanh_so_7_cai_dat_hdh_linux.pdf

Nội dung text: Thực hành Hệ điều hành - Bài thực hành số 7: Cài đặt HDH Linux + Boot Loader

  1. Khoa Công Nghệ Thông Tin - Đại Học Khoa Học Tự Nhiên Bộ Môn Mạng Máy Tính và Viễn Thông Thực hiện khởi động từ đĩa cài Fedora Core 5, giao diện cài đặt sẽ như hình dưới: Có thể mất một vài phút để kiểm tra đĩa cài Fedora Core 5. Chọn “Skip” để bỏ qua việc kiểm tra này.
  2. Khoa Công Nghệ Thông Tin - Đại Học Khoa Học Tự Nhiên Bộ Môn Mạng Máy Tính và Viễn Thông Nếu cài đặt Fedora trên một máy tính mới, chưa cài bất cứ hệ điều hành nào khác thì sẽ chọn “yes” để format toàn bộ ổ cứng và cài duy nhất hệ điều hành Fedora Core 5 nên máy tính:
  3. Khoa Công Nghệ Thông Tin - Đại Học Khoa Học Tự Nhiên Bộ Môn Mạng Máy Tính và Viễn Thông Thiết lập mật khẩu gốc cho user: root (là admin lớn nhất với FedoraCore 5) Tiếp theo là bước chọn các gói để cài, chọn những gói cần thiết tuỳ vào mục đích sử dụng, ở đây ta chọn 2 lựa chọn là “Web Server” và “Software Development”.
  4. Khoa Công Nghệ Thông Tin - Đại Học Khoa Học Tự Nhiên Bộ Môn Mạng Máy Tính và Viễn Thông
  5. Khoa Công Nghệ Thông Tin - Đại Học Khoa Học Tự Nhiên Bộ Môn Mạng Máy Tính và Viễn Thông IV Tổng quan Boot Loader GRUB: GRUB là trình khởi động máy tính – nó có nhiệm vụ tải nhân và khởi động hệ thống Linux cũng như một số hệ điều hành khác: FreeBSD, NetBSD, OpenBSD, GNU HURD, DOS, Windows 95, 98, Me, NT, 2000 và XP Năm 1995, Erich Boley thiết kế GRUB. Năm 1999, Gordon Matzigkeit và Yoshinori K. Okuji kế thừa GRUB thành gói phần mềm GNU chính thức. • GRUB hỗ trợ nhiều hệ điều hành – bằng cách khởi động trực tiếp nhân hệ điều hành hoặc bằng cách nạp chuỗi (chain-loading). • GRUB hỗ trợ nhiều hệ thống tập tin: BSD FFS, DOS FAT16 và FAT32, Minix fs, Linux ext2fs và ext3fs, ReiserFS, JSF, XFS, và VSTa fs. • GRUB cung cấp giao diện dòng lệnh linh hoạt lẫn giao diện thực đơn, đồng thời cũng hỗ trợ tập tin cấu hình. V. Cài đặt GRUB: 1. Nơi tải GRUB xuống: GRUB có sẵn ở hoặc các mirror của nó. Tên gói GRUB có dạng grub-version.tar.gz, thí dụ grub-1.96.tar.gz. Một số hệ điều hành cung cấp GRUB dưới dạng đóng gói riêng, chẳng hạn như dạng rpm (có thể tìm thấy trong các bản phân phối Red Hat, SUSE ), dạng deb (trong bản phân phối Debian). 2. Cài đặt GRUB trong môi trường Linux Cần phân biệt 2 bước của cài đặt GRUB: (i) cài đặt trong môi trường hệ điều hành để có thể sử dụng được GRUB và, (ii) cài đặt GRUB để GRUB làm trình khởi động máy tính. Bước 2 sẽ được đề cập trong chương Sử dụng GRUB. Sau khi tải về một thư mục thích hợp, giải nén bằng lệnh tar xzvf grub-1.96.tar.gz Sau đó: # cd grub-1.96 #./configure # make # make install
  6. Khoa Công Nghệ Thông Tin - Đại Học Khoa Học Tự Nhiên Bộ Môn Mạng Máy Tính và Viễn Thông - title: Tiêu đề HĐH (tên hiển thị của HĐH) - root: partition chứa HĐH - kernel: vị trí kernel - initrd : thiết lập các thông số đĩa RAM VI. Bảo mật cho GRUB bằng cách thiết lập Password: [root@localhost ~]# /sbin/grub-md5-crypt Password: Retype password: $1$ExmBw$6ZMeJDQRmqNhy.NAOdyZK0 Copy mật khẩu được mã hoá bằng MD5 , sau đó thêm vào file cấu hình Grub /etc/grub.conf như sau: Phía dưới dòng timeout thêm vào: password –md5 ( giá trị mà ta vừa hash ở trên)